PFAS detected
“Forever chemicals” from UCMR-5 — the only fresh nationwide measurements (2023–2025).
| Contaminant | Max | Detection rate | Period |
|---|---|---|---|
| PFHxS | 0.0092 ug/L | 2/6 | 2024 |
| PFOS | 0.0103 ug/L | 2/6 | 2024 |
Other contaminants detected
| Contaminant | Max | Detection rate | Source | Period |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| COPPER, FREE | 218 UG/L | 68/69 | SYR4 | 2012–2019 |
| Nitrate-Nitrite | 860 UG/L | 50/50 | SYR4 | 2012–2019 |
| Lead | 3.08 UG/L | 23/68 | SYR4 | 2012–2019 |
| LEAD SUMMARY | 0.0056 mg/L | 19/19 | LCR | 2025 |
| Barium | 50.8 UG/L | 9/9 | SYR4 | 2012–2018 |
| Chromium | 3.24 UG/L | 6/9 | SYR4 | 2012–2018 |
| Toluene | 1.87 UG/L | 1/22 | SYR4 | 2012–2019 |
